Senior Frontend Engineer at iRecharge Tech-Innovations

Confidential

Lagos, Nigeria Permanent

Published 1 month ago · Expires 3 weeks from now

Share :

Job description

## Title: Senior Frontend Engineer

About the Role

We're looking for a Senior Frontend Engineer who doesn't just write code—you build experiences that people love to use. This role is for someone who takes complete ownership of the features they build, from the first line of code to the moment users interact with it in production.

As our Senior Frontend Engineer, you'll be the technical force behind our user-facing products. You'll work with React to build fast, beautiful, and accessible interfaces while collaborating closely with designers, product managers, and backend engineers.

We need someone who can architect solutions, mentor others, and ship quality code consistently—not someone who waits to be told exactly what to do.

Key Responsibilities

Technical Ownership & Delivery

  • Take complete ownership of frontend features from design handoff through production deployment
  • Build and maintain high-performance React applications that scale with growing user demands
  • Write clean, maintainable, and well-tested code that other engineers can easily understand and extend
  • Make architectural decisions that balance user experience, performance, and maintainability
  • Ship features on time without compromising on quality

React Expertise & Architecture

  • Design and implement complex React applications using modern patterns (hooks, context, custom hooks, etc.)
  • Build reusable component libraries that maintain consistency across products
  • Optimize application performance through code splitting, lazy loading, and efficient re-rendering strategies
  • Implement state management solutions that scale (Context API, Redux, Zustand, or similar)
  • Create responsive, mobile-first designs that work seamlessly across all devices and browsers

Code Quality & Best Practices

  • Write comprehensive tests (unit, integration, and end-to-end) to ensure code reliability
  • Conduct thorough code reviews, providing constructive feedback

Interested in this job?

Log in to see the email

Not registered yet? Create a free account